【Git私服】搭建私有git仓库,免密pull and push

本文介绍了在CentOS 7服务器上安装和配置Git,以创建私有Git仓库并实现客户端的免密Push和Pull操作。步骤包括:检查服务器的CentOS版本,安装Git,配置Git系统用户,初始化仓库,设置SSH公钥,开放RSA认证,以及客户端生成和上传SSH密钥对。
摘要由CSDN通过智能技术生成

基础系统环境

服务器系统:CentOS Linux release 7.4.1708 (Core) (查看centos版本命令:lsb_release -a)
客户端系统:Windows 7

服务器端安装git

1.检查当前版本

// 查看当前git版本
# git --version
git version 1.7.1

// 如果版本还是2一下的建议卸载旧版本
# yum remove -y git

2.下载git

# 直接下载
# wget https://github.com/git/git/archive/v2.13.2.tar.gz

#或者通过其他其他渠道下载并放置于/usr/local 下面
# tar zxf v2.13.2.tar.gz

3 . 编译,安装,环境变量

# cd git-2.13.2
# make prefix=/usr/local/git all
# make prefix=/usr/local/git install
# echo "export PATH=$PATH:/usr/local/git/bin" >> /etc/bashrc
# source /etc/bashrc    // 实时生效 

  1. 查看git版本号,正确显示则安装成功
# git --version
git version 2.13.2

服务器端配置

1.生成一个git系统用户
(建议git 设置为普通用户,如果遇到特

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值